The image presents a view looking down a quiet, narrow street lined with buildings under an overcast sky. On the left, multi-story buildings are constructed from red brick, featuring prominent white window frames and intricate architectural details, including decorative brick patterns and cornices. Some windows show interior blinds. On the right side of the street, the buildings are lighter in color, possibly white or cream, also with white trim and window frames. A flag pole extends from one of these structures. The street is paved with red-brown bricks laid in a herringbone pattern, with a distinct, narrower section of paving running parallel to it on the right. Numerous bicycles are parked along the right side of the street, some standing upright, others having fallen over. Regularly spaced street lights and poles with various signs line this side of the pavement. A conspicuous red and white circular "No Entry" sign is visible on one of the poles. Bare trees or shrubs are sparsely distributed along the building fronts. The sky is a uniform, pale grey, indicating an overcast day, without direct sunlight. There are no people visible, contributing to a calm and serene atmosphere. The characteristic architecture, brick paving, and prevalence of bicycles strongly suggest a Dutch urban setting, consistent with Utrecht. The scene depicts daytime, likely a cloudy morning or afternoon.
